Part IV: Development Strategies — the Governance Dimension
Part IV explores how the effort to build governance institutions capable of supporting ongoing development momentum might be approached strategically. The aim is to identify an initial round of actions which opens up the path for later stages of the journey, to assess constraints that might inhibit this initial round of actions and, as needed, to identify alternative pathways that get around those constraints – to help clarify what is to be done, how, and by whom. But before scoping out the contours of the way forward, more needs to be said about how the governance and development discourse has evolved.
